"I had over a dozen unfinished games, and a handful of finished ones as well. One involved driving a tank...
"Tank game was top-down, and was sort of like a Space Invaders style game, pitting you against waves of enemies before you could progress to the next stage. As I recall the last enemy would drop a key that let you progress."
